    ABOUT THE POSITION: 

     

    Polk State College is hiring an ADJUNCT INSTRUCTOR FOR GRAPHIC DESIGN to join the Digital Media Technology faculty team. The primary role of this position is to provide college-level instruction and instruction-related activities to encourage, support, and enable students' success. If you work for Polk State, you will join a talented and dedicated academic community working hard to prepare tomorrow's leaders.

     

    The position is a non-tenure track, term-to-term, temporary, faculty assignment. In this role, you will teach courses in graphic design, digital publishing, UI/UX, and myriad topics in digital media. Courses may be scheduled in morning, afternoon, or evening sessions and are primarily offered in a face-to-face format.

     

    We are seeking a faculty member who will be an effective instructor willing to explore creative strategies to help students master critical content in digital media. The chosen candidate must be committed to course planning, instructional preparation, personal learning, and most importantly, student success.

     

    Candidates for this role will have strong academic credentials along with hands-on expertise in digital media and excellent instructional skills. We are seeking someone who has strong skills in graphic design and media principles and is also able to use industry-standard tools to demonstrate these principles, step-by-step, from conception to a fully-realized, completed, professional product. In other words, someone who can explain the concepts well and demonstrate them through hands-on, professional projects.

     

    The selected candidate will be patient, respectful, and able to communicate effectively to diverse students of varying economic and educational levels. He or she will care about students and be passionate about teaching effectively. The instructor will incorporate project-based learning as part of the instructional strategy and will actively infuse strategic assessments to inform pedagogical effectiveness.

     

    Additionally, the instructor will welcome feedback in the classroom and embrace change if current instructional strategies are less than optimal. He or she will prepare relevant instructional content before classes, respond to emails promptly, and address student needs quickly and professionally.

     

    If chosen, the instructor will work closely with the campus Academic Dean and the Department Coordinator or Program Director.

     

    Adjuncts are paid at a rate of $34.38/HR.
